Building Your Digital Relationship Strategy

The path forward requires three key elements:

1. Integration over fragmentation

Stop using disconnected tools for email marketing, social media, lead generation, and customer service. Each disconnection creates relationship friction.

Instead, prioritize systems that create a unified customer view. When marketing knows what sales knows, and service knows what marketing knows, customers feel understood rather than processed.

2. Automation with intelligence

Basic automation sends the same message to everyone who takes the same action. Intelligent automation understands context.

It recognizes that a first-time website visitor needs different engagement than a returning prospect. It knows when to offer help versus when to offer an upgrade.

This contextual awareness transforms automation from merely efficient to genuinely effective.

3. Continuous relationship nurturing

The biggest digital relationship mistake? Treating acquisition as the finish line rather than the starting point.

Smart businesses build systems that continuously nurture relationships through every lifecycle stage. They recognize that retention, expansion, and advocacy deserve as much automated intelligence as acquisition.

What This Looks Like In Practice

Imagine a small business consultant who implements an integrated, AI-powered system. Here's what changes:

When a prospect downloads a guide, the system doesn't just deliver the PDF and add them to a generic newsletter. It analyzes their behavior, compares it to successful customer patterns, and automatically tailors the follow-up sequence.

It might send case studies to prospects showing research behaviors, or practical worksheets to those showing implementation intent.

For existing clients, the system monitors engagement signals, proactively identifies potential issues before they become problems, and suggests relevant additional services based on actual usage patterns.

This level of relationship intelligence once required a dedicated account manager for each client. Now it's accessible to small businesses through AI-powered systems.
